Constantinos Ioannou highlights the Interior Ministry's achievements during 2025

The achievements of the Ministry of Interior in 2025 have been highlighted in a statement by the Minister of Interior, Constantinos Ioannou, announcing substantial changes in the Departments of Town Planning and Land Registry in 2026.

As he notes, "in a few hours we will say goodbye to 2025, a year with significant challenges, but also substantial reforms."

As the Ministry of Interior, Constantinou adds:

  • We further strengthened housing policy, providing more solutions and choices, especially for young people and young couples.
  • By streamlining the management of Turkish Cypriot properties, we have strengthened transparency, equality and meritocracy.
  • We implemented rapid development licensing, reducing delays and inconvenience for citizens and businesses.
  • With the urban planning amnesty, we enabled thousands of our fellow citizens who remained trapped for years to issue property titles.

"In 2026, we are moving forward with substantial changes in the Departments of Town Planning and Land Registry, aiming for modern services, less bureaucracy and better service," he emphasises.

Tomorrow, Ioannou continues, "our country assumes the Presidency of the Council of the European Union. It is an important responsibility , but also a great opportunity to actively contribute to European decisions and to strengthen the voice and prestige of Cyprus in Europe."

"I wish everyone health, strength and a better 2026," the Minister of Interior concludes.
